释义 | > as lemmaslow-density lipoprotein low-density lipoprotein n. Biochemistry any of a class of lipoproteins which have a relatively low density and a higher content of cholesterol than other classes of plasma lipoprotein, and which transport cholesterol to peripheral tissues in the body; abbreviated LDL. ΚΠ 1947 K. O. Pedersen in Jrnl. Physical & Colloid Chem. 51 156 (title) On a low-density lipoprotein appearing in normal human plasma. 1979 Compl. Bk. Roller Skating vi. 87 The bad guys are the low-density lipoproteins which transport the cholesterol that is deposited on the linings of your blood vessels. 2007 Independent 15 Jan. 6/5 Experts..had found the strongest link yet between Low-density lipoprotein (LDL) cholesterol levels and Parkinson's. < as lemmas |
